Hundreds of people parade through the streets of Lerwick, on Scotland’s Shetland Islands as part of the annual Up Helly Aa festivities.
The fire festival celebrates the influence of the Scandinavian Vikings in the Shetland Islands and culminates with up to 1,000 ‘guizers’ (men in costume) throwing flaming torches into their Viking longboat and setting it alight.
